Yamato, Mountain town in Kamimashiki District, Japan.
Description
Yamato is a town in northeastern Kumamoto Prefecture that sits on elevated plateaus surrounded by mountain ranges. The community includes schools and local government facilities that serve residents across its rural landscape.
History
The town was established in 2005 when three separate municipalities merged into a single administrative unit. This merger combined communities from different districts to form a larger municipality.

Did you know?
The highland elevation favors the cultivation of mountain vegetables on numerous farms throughout the area. This agricultural focus shapes the daily rhythm and local economy.
